The newsgroup server run by the university I attend requires a password to do anything. Because of this, after I subscribe to a group and double-click on its entry in the folder list (expecting a list of subjects of posts to the newsgroup to appear), I get an error message: "Unexpected server response from xover: 480 Authentication required for command." There doesn't seem to be any mechanism to force evolution to authenticate before trying to run the command or react to the error by authenticating and trying again.
try forgetting passwords and trying again it should handle auth transparently, and ask for a password if required. if that fails run evolution with CAMEL_DEBUG=all set in the environment and attach the log of nntp traffic here when you try to access the server.
